Output 8cadd567659ebdd22e6def02471d280a66a04f98c7b6a93dd4c428beb251e622:1

value
667826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344e1ec69baeaf1bfc54acc2a35088186df81935 OP_EQUAL
address
36TaeQYsCXMU11nGS7jPshJ5U5mVMzYpAd
transaction
8cadd567659ebdd22e6def02471d280a66a04f98c7b6a93dd4c428beb251e622
spent
true